UserControl.SaveViewState Metoda

Definicja

Zapisuje wszelkie zmiany stanu widoku kontroli użytkownika, które wystąpiły od czasu ostatniego powrotu strony.

protected:
 override System::Object ^ SaveViewState();
protected override object SaveViewState ();
override this.SaveViewState : unit -> obj
Protected Overrides Function SaveViewState () As Object

Zwraca

Object

Zwraca bieżący stan widoku kontrolki użytkownika. Jeśli nie ma stanu widoku skojarzonego z kontrolką, zwraca wartość null.

Przykłady

W poniższym przykładzie pokazano kontrolkę użytkownika, która zarządza stanem widoku przy użyciu LoadViewState metod i SaveViewState .

public string UserText
{
    get
    {
        return (string)ViewState["usertext"];
    }
    set
    {
        ViewState["usertext"] = value;
    }
}
public string PasswordText
{
    get
    {
        return (string)ViewState["passwordtext"];
    }
    set
    {
        ViewState["passwordtext"] = value;
    }
}

[System.Security.Permissions.PermissionSet(System.Security.Permissions.SecurityAction.Demand, Name="FullTrust")] 
protected override void LoadViewState(object savedState) 
{
    object[] totalState = null;	   
    if (savedState != null)
    {
        totalState = (object[])savedState;
        if (totalState.Length != 3)
        {
            // Throw an appropriate exception.
        }
        // Load base state.
        base.LoadViewState(totalState[0]);
        // Load extra information specific to this control.
        if (totalState != null && totalState[1] != null && totalState[2] != null)
        {
            UserText = (string)totalState[1];
            PasswordText = (string)totalState[2];
        }
    }
}

[System.Security.Permissions.PermissionSet(System.Security.Permissions.SecurityAction.Demand, Name="FullTrust")] 
protected override object SaveViewState()
{
    object baseState = base.SaveViewState();
    object[] totalState = new object[3];
    totalState[0] = baseState;
    totalState[1] = user.Text;
    totalState[2] = password.Text;
    return totalState;
}

Uwagi

Ogólnie rzecz biorąc, nie trzeba wywoływać tej metody. Jeśli jednak przechowujesz informacje niestandardowe w stanie widoku, możesz zastąpić tę metodę, aby to zrobić.
